What is the walking level?
Walking Level
Daily Mileage Options: 2-7 miles
Route Notes:
This trip includes paved and cobblestone streets in Naples, Capri, Sorrento and Amalfi villages, plus countryside and coastal trails, terraced vineyard paths, and shepherds’ tracks. Footpaths follow hillside terraces with some rock-carved stairs. Expect elevation changes along coastal and hillside sections.
